Calc. Error Unacked Quality (CERRUQ) ......................................................................... – WR
If the calculation error diagnostic is enabled, this status indicates if the quality of the
unacknowledged diagnostic is GOOD or BAD. Only writeable in DEBUG.

GOOD

0

Quality when the loop block is RUN or HOLD.

BAD

1

Quality when the loop block is OFF.

08

Calc. Error Active (CERRA) ............................................................................................. – WR
If the calculation error diagnostic is enabled, the active status indicates if the diagnostic is
active even after acknowledgement. Only writeable in DEBUG.

NO

0

Diagnostic error is not active.

YES

1

Diagnostic error is active.

09

Calc. Error Active Quality (CERRAQ) ............................................................................. – WR
If the calculation error diagnostic is enabled, this status indicates if the quality of the active
diagnostic is GOOD or BAD. Only writeable in DEBUG.

GOOD

0

Quality when the loop block is RUN or HOLD.

BAD

1

Quality when the loop block is OFF.

10

Output (R)...........................................................................................................................CWR
value

Fixed initial Floating-Point value for linearizer. After initial group scan interval, the

algorithm’s linearized output value is the output.

11

Result Quality (RQ)............................................................................................................CWR
Result quality depends on how ‘bad inputs accepted’ and ‘set quality bad on calculation error?’
attributes are configured.
